Historic Old Town Alexandria
Before you hit the road, take some time to explore Historic Old Town Alexandria. This charming waterfront town is a must-visit for anyone interested in American history. Founded in 1749, Old Town Alexandria is packed with historic landmarks and museums, as well as shops, restaurants, and cafes.
Some of the must-see landmarks in Old Town include the George Washington Masonic National Memorial, the Torpedo Factory Art Center, and the Carlyle House Historic Park. And if you're a fan of shopping and dining, you'll love exploring the many boutiques and eateries that line King Street.

Wolf Trap National Park for the Performing Arts
If you're a fan of the arts and nature, you won't want to miss Wolf Trap National Park for the Performing Arts. This beautiful park is home to a variety of outdoor performance spaces, which host concerts, theatrical productions, and other events throughout the year.
In addition to the performances, the park also features miles of hiking trails, beautiful gardens, and picnic areas. So whether you're a culture vulture looking for a night out or a nature lover seeking some fresh air, Wolf Trap National Park has something for everyone.
Great Falls Park
Another beautiful natural attraction to visit along the way is Great Falls Park. Located just a short drive from Dunn Loring, this park offers stunning views of the Potomac River and its cascading waterfalls.
Visitors can enjoy a variety of outdoor activities at Great Falls Park, including hiking, kayaking, and fishing. The park also has picnic areas, a visitor center, and educational programs for visitors of all ages.
